  • Reliability (3)
    3 out of 5 stars
    While Mercedes-Benz has made strides in reliability, some owners of previous models have reported occasional electronic glitches. We anticipate the 2026 model to be on par with recent improvements, but it's not typically a class leader in long-term dependability.
  • Maintenance (2)
    2 out of 5 stars
    As a premium brand, Mercedes-Benz maintenance costs tend to be higher than average. Parts and labor for routine servicing and unexpected repairs can be quite expensive, which is a common characteristic of luxury vehicles.
  • Technology (5)
    5 out of 5 stars
    Mercedes-Benz continues to excel in technology, and the GLA 250 is no exception. It features the intuitive MBUX infotainment system with voice control, a crisp digital instrument cluster, and a comprehensive suite of advanced driver-assistance systems.
  • Comfort (4)
    4 out of 5 stars
    The interior is well-appointed with comfortable seats and a generally smooth ride. Road noise is well-managed, contributing to a pleasant cabin experience, though the rear seats can be a bit snug for taller passengers.
  • Dynamics (4)
    4 out of 5 stars
    The 2026 GLA 250 offers a nimble and engaging driving experience for a compact SUV, with responsive steering and good body control. While not a sports car, it handles city driving and winding roads with confidence.

2026 Mercedes-Benz GLA: A Sophisticated Compact SUV Evolution

The 2026 Mercedes-Benz GLA is poised to continue its reign as a stylish and dynamic entry in the premium compact SUV segment. While Mercedes-Benz typically keeps its model year updates focused on refinement rather than radical overhauls, the 2026 GLA is expected to bring a blend of updated technology, enhanced comfort, and continued emphasis on its sporty character. It aims to appeal to a discerning buyer looking for a premium experience in a more accessible package, blending SUV practicality with Mercedes-Benz luxury and driving dynamics.

Highlights

  • Powertrain Refinement: While specific details for the 2026 model are subject to official confirmation, it's highly probable that the GLA will retain its efficient and capable turbocharged four-cylinder engines. Expect the familiar 2.0-liter turbocharged engine as the core offering, likely tuned for optimal balance between performance and fuel economy. Performance variants, such as the GLA 35 AMG and potentially a more potent GLA 45 AMG, will undoubtedly continue to deliver exhilarating acceleration and a more aggressive driving experience with their higher-output versions of the same engine, paired with Mercedes-AMG's signature performance tuning. All-wheel drive (4MATIC) will likely remain a prominent option, enhancing traction and stability in various driving conditions.
  • Advanced Safety Features: Mercedes-Benz is renowned for its commitment to safety, and the 2026 GLA will be no exception. Buyers can anticipate a comprehensive suite of standard and optional adv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S). Key features will likely include:
    • Active Brake Assist: Utilizes radar and camera sensors to detect potential collisions with vehicles, pedestrians, or cyclists, and can automatically apply the brakes to mitigate or avoid impact.
    • Active Lane Keeping Assist: Employs cameras to monitor lane markings and can steer the vehicle back into its lane if it detects unintentional drifting.
    • Blind Spot Assist: Warns the driver of vehicles in their blind spots, typically with visual and audible alerts, and can also intervene with steering correction.
    • Traffic Sign Assist: Recognizes and displays traffic signs (speed limits, stop signs, etc.) on the instrument cluster and infotainment screen.
    • PRE-SAFE® System: A suite of preventative safety measures that can detect an imminent collision and prepare the vehicle and occupants by tightening seatbelts, adjusting seat positions, and closing windows.
    • Optional additions may include adaptive cruise control with steering assist, advanced parking assistance, and a 360-degree camera system.
  • Trim Level Excellence: The 2023 GLA lineup offers distinct personalities, and this is expected to carry forward. The expected trims include:
    • GLA 250: The entry point to the GLA experience, offering a well-rounded package of premium features, comfort, and everyday usability.
    • GLA 35 AMG: A sportier iteration that elevates performance with enhanced engine output, sport-tuned suspension, and more aggressive styling cues, catering to those seeking a more engaging drive.
    • GLA 45 AMG (if available): The pinnacle of GLA performance, delivering blistering acceleration and track-inspired handling for the true driving enthusiast.
  • Infotainment and Connectivity: The MBUX (Mercedes-Benz User Experience) infotainment system is a cornerstone of the GLA's interior. For 2026, expect further enhancements to the dual-screen setup, likely featuring a larger or more integrated display for both the instrument cluster and the central infotainment screen. Advanced voice control, seamless smartphone integration (Apple CarPlay and Android Auto), and over-the-air software updates will continue to be standard, keeping the vehicle's technology current.
  • Design Evolution: While not a complete redesign, the 2026 GLA will likely receive subtle exterior styling tweaks to keep it fresh. This could include revised front and rear bumper designs, updated LED lighting signatures, and potentially new wheel designs, all contributing to a more contemporary and sophisticated appearance.

What to Expect

The ownership experience of a 2026 Mercedes-Benz GLA is characterized by a premium feel and a focus on comfort and technology. The interior is expected to be well-appointed, featuring high-quality materials, comfortable seating, and a driver-centric cockpit. Daily driving will be a pleasure, with a refined ride quality that absorbs road imperfections effectively, while still offering a sense of agility and responsiveness.

Maintenance for a Mercedes-Benz typically involves scheduled service intervals recommended by the manufacturer. These services will likely include oil changes, fluid checks, filter replacements, and inspections of various components. While Mercedes-Benz vehicles are built to high standards, maintenance costs can be higher compared to non-premium brands due to the specialized parts and labor required. Many owners opt for a prepaid maintenance plan to help manage these costs.

Insurance premiums for a Mercedes-Benz GLA will generally be higher than for more common compact SUVs. This is due to factors such as the vehicle's purchase price, its advanced technology and safety features (which can be expensive to repair), and the brand's premium positioning. Comprehensive and collision coverage will be essential, and shopping around for quotes from different insurance providers is recommended.

Potential Considerations

  • Rear Seat and Cargo Space: As a compact SUV, the GLA prioritizes agility and a stylish profile, which can sometimes come at the expense of maximum interior space. While the rear seats are generally comfortable for two adults, three across can be a squeeze, and cargo volume, though adequate for daily needs, might be less than some larger competitors.
  • Ride Firmness in AMG Variants: While the AMG models offer thrilling performance, their sport-tuned suspensions can result in a firmer ride, which some drivers might find less comfortable on longer journeys or rougher road surfaces.
  • Technology Complexity: While the MBUX system is sophisticated and feature-rich, its extensive customization options and various menus can have a learning curve for some users.

Overall Summary

The 2026 Mercedes-Benz GLA is set to continue its appeal as a compelling option for those seeking a luxurious and technologically advanced compact SUV. With its refined powertrains, comprehensive safety suite, and the signature Mercedes-Benz blend of comfort and style, it offers a sophisticated entry into the premium SUV segment. While potential buyers should be mindful of its compact dimensions and the typical cost of premium vehicle ownership, the GLA remains a strong contender for those who value brand prestige, cutting-edge technology, and an engaging driving experience.
